The Morning Star

Peter Bursky explores the Buddha’s experience of seeing the Morning Star when he was sitting under the Bodhi tree. Yamada Roshi once said, “the basis and central focus of Buddhism is the enlightenment experience of Shakyamuni Buddha.” Rohatsu (8 December) is normally the day on which we, together with Zen communities throughout the world, celebrate the Buddha’s realisation.


This talk – Case 1 of the Denkoroku “The Buddha’s Morning Star” – was given at Rohatsu sesshin 2020
